VIDEO: Barnett on Briggs of Burton Pre-Season Marquee

Wednesday 18th January 2017
Written by Danny Painter

Director of Cricket, Kim Barnett, says remaining in Derby and training in the Briggs of Burton Pre-Season Marquee will provide the squad the best preparation for the new season. 

The squad will train on pitches within the purpose-built structure from February to the start of April. The marquee, sponsored by stainless steel specialists and long-standing Club partners Briggs of Burton, will measure 750m².

It has been specially developed to feature innovative ClearLight panels to allow in as much natural light as possible for the players, while also promoting healthy grass growth during the winter months.

Barnett said: “We have decided to not go on a pre-season tour and will be here all the way through to the start of the new campaign. We will have the Briggs of Burton Pre-Season Marquee in the middle of the square for nine weeks and will get five weeks practice out of it on our own pitch.

“I think, particularly with the 50 over competition, this will give us a chance to be spot on in English conditions and give us the best chance to start the season well.

“The overseas tour has it’s own merit in terms of bonding, but you will often play on pitches that are nothing like England in April and May. Instead, we will be looking to use our own pitches all the way through up until our first matches.”
